WebApr 6, 2024 · Johnson scored a 72.9% landslide in the Far North Side’s 49 th Ward. He topped the 60% mark in the 46 th and 48 th Wards and managed to win 31.2% of the vote in the 43 rd Ward, which includes the affluent and crime-weary residents of Lincoln Park.
